Endeavor Group, often referred to simply as Endeavor, is a prominent player in the US entertainment and media industry, headquartered in the heart of Los Angeles, California. Founded in 1995, the company has evolved into a global powerhouse, with significant operations across North America, Europe, and Asia. Specialising in talent representation, sports management, and media production, Endeavor Group distinguishes itself through its innovative approach and commitment to client success. The company’s diverse portfolio includes the renowned Endeavor Talent Agency and the sports marketing firm WME, showcasing its unique ability to bridge the gap between talent and opportunity. With a strong market position, Endeavor has achieved notable milestones, including the successful acquisition of IMG and the establishment of the Endeavor Streaming platform. These achievements underscore its influence and leadership within the entertainment sector, making Endeavor Group a key player in shaping the future of media and sports.

In 2022, Endeavor Group reported total carbon emissions of approximately 65,697,000 kg CO2e, comprising 10,427,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1 and 54,602,000 kg CO2e from Scope 2 emissions. The Scope 1 emissions included mobile combustion (347,000 kg CO2e), process emissions (333,000 kg CO2e), fugitive emissions (7,800 kg CO2e), and stationary combustion (436,000 kg CO2e). For Scope 2, the majority of emissions stemmed from purchased electricity, amounting to 44,174,000 kg CO2e. In 2021, the company reported total emissions of approximately 59,562,000 kg CO2e, with Scope 1 emissions at 9,142,000 kg CO2e and Scope 2 emissions at 50,315,000 kg CO2e. This indicates a rise in emissions from 2021 to 2022, highlighting the need for enhanced climate action. Endeavor Group has not disclosed any specific reduction targets or initiatives, nor does it report on Scope 3 emissions. The absence of Science-Based Targets Initiative (SBTi) commitments suggests a potential area for improvement in their climate strategy. The emissions data is sourced directly from Endeavor Group Holdings, Inc., with no cascaded data from parent organisations.

Climate goals typically focus on 2030 interim targets and 2050 net-zero commitments, aligned with global frameworks like the Paris Agreement and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) to ensure alignment with global climate goals.
Endeavor Group has not publicly committed to specific 2030 or 2050 climate goals through the major frameworks we track. Companies often set interim 2030 targets and long-term 2050 net-zero goals to demonstrate measurable progress toward decarbonization.
